About the cabin: Making Memories Too provides a 'home away from home' feel. It is beautifully decorated two-story cabin with no detail spared! The cabin features 2 bedrooms with queen size beds, a bonus room (like a den) featuring a day bed with trundle which sleeps two. It is perfect for a children's room. There are two full bathrooms, one upstairs and one downstairs. A pool table/game area is located in the upstairs loft. There are a total of 4 TV's in the cabin. The kitchen is fully stocked with pots, pans, dishes, glasses, silverware, microwave, and coffee pot. Outside, the cabin has a convenient wrap around deck with a hot tub for 6 people, a charcoal grill, picnic table, and rocking chairs to sit and enjoy the natural surroundings. The cabin sits on an almost 1/2 acre leveled yard, perfect for the children to run around in! Three cars can comfortably park on its driveway.

We had reservations for 6 adults and only had linens for 5, this is not new issue as other reviews had this problem as well. We arrived around 1am in the morning after driving over 900 miles so had no way to get linens then the next morning the power went out and I found the main breaker tripped, I have a background in electrical and found that the main breaker was only 100 amp, which was undersized for the all electric cabin and not installed according to electrical code. I contacted the owners and they was rude and telling me that they live over a thousand miles away and it was late Friday evening and holidays so they didn’t want to bother. I finally convinced them to try to find electrician to correct the issue, they got someone to come look but they couldn’t fix the issue without replacing the entire electrical panel ro the proper in code 200amp panel.so we had to sleep with no heat when the temperature was in the low 20’s the small 100amp service breaker was burnt and very weak from overheating due to being overloaded for extended periods of time. To top off everything dealing with the incompetence of the owners they had nerve to tell me to leave the heat off inside and keep the power on their hot tub so it wouldn’t freeze.
